Online MS in Computer Science
Earn your master’s degree online from the #1 public computer science program in New England.

UMass Amherst’s online MS in computer science is a flexible, 30-credit program perfect any busy tech professional. Advance your career by deepening your knowledge of AI, machine learning, and other innovative concepts.
Ranked among the top public computer science programs in the US, our program focuses on the skills needed to solve complex problems through computing.
Our fully online program lets you fit in coursework around your schedule.
The hybrid track allows you to complete four courses online and then transfer into the in-person program.
This program will prepare you for rewarding work across every industry, from finance to tech and beyond.
The online program offers the same rigor as our in-person program.
Learn how to solve real-world societal challenges.
Leverage AI, machine learning, data science, and other advanced computing solutions to address the world's problems.
Projected job growth in computer science through 2029 according to the U.S. Bureau of Labor Statistics.
Alumni worldwide are working in computing roles across sectors—from health care and finance to technology and the arts
Median starting salary of graduates of our master’s programs.